Intel® Directed I/O Virtualization Technology (VT-d) ‡
Intel® Directed I/O Virtualization Technology (VT-d) builds on existing support for virtualization solutions for the IA-32 (VT-x) and Itanium® processor-based systems (VT-i) and adds new support for I/O device virtualization. Intel VT-d can help users improve system security and reliability, as well as I/O device performance in virtualized environments.

Intel® Virtualization Technology (VT-x) ‡
Intel® Virtualization Technology (VT-x) enables one hardware platform to be deployed as multiple “virtual” platforms, providing improved manageability through reduced downtime and maintaining productivity by moving compute operations to separate partitions.

Intel® ME Firmware Version
Intel® Management Engine Firmware (Intel® ME FW) uses built-in platform features and management and security applications to remotely manage out-of-band computers within a network.

Intel® Optane™ memory supported ‡
Intel® Optane™ memory is a revolutionary new class of persistent memory that sits between system memory and storage to accelerate system performance and responsiveness. Combined with the Intel® Rapid Storage Technology driver, it seamlessly manages multiple tiers of storage while providing a virtual disk to the operating system, ensuring that frequently accessed data is on the fastest tier. Intel® Platform Trust Technology (Intel® PTT)
Intel® Platform Trust Technology (Intel® PTT) is a platform functionality for credential storage and key management, and is used by Windows 8* and Windows® 10. Intel® PTT supports BitLocker* for disk encryption and supports all Microsoft requirements for Firmware Trusted Platform Module (fTPM) 2.0.
